あゆゆん♪ @ayu_littlewing 今度はエンジニアたちの面談してたんだけど、最近の子ほんと「一生エンジニア」やりたがるのね。 30歳さしかかるんだからそろそろ部下を持てと言ってるんだけどなぁ。 いつまでも振られたIssueをプルリクにするお仕事だけしてても今後のキャリアどうするんだ?? エンジニアにもレイヤーはあるだろ? 2024-03-26 16:33:37
Q.プログラマーです。自宅でテレワーク勤務するとき、音楽を聴きながら作業しています。習慣化してしまい、音楽がないと調子が出ません。最近出社した際、イヤホンを使って聴いていたところ、それに気づいた上司から注意されました。迷惑はかけていないと反論しましたが取り合ってくれません。「やめなさい」と注意されるほどのものでしょうか。 音楽を聴くことにはリラックス効果がある上、モチベーションも上がるという説があるようです。効果について筆者は専門外なので、職場のルールという観点からお答えします。 イヤホンで音楽を聴きながら仕事をする、これを許すか許さないかは会社が決めることになります。上司は個人的見解で判断してはいけません。他の組織と整合性が取れなくなります。 音楽を流す方針の会社も 会社には、社員が働きやすい職場環境になるように整える義務があります。リラックス効果を考慮して、音楽を流している会社もありま
キチガイに刃物、ゴミプログラマに継承。危険なものは取り上げるべきだ。 オブジェクト指向プログラミングにおける継承は強力な手法であるが、これを正しく使えるプログラマは残念なことに極めて少ない。たいていの場合、継承を使うことで却ってプログラムの保守を困難にしてしまう。継承のアンチパターンの最たるものは、単なるメソッドやメンバ変数の共有のために継承を使うパターンだ。これを行うとデータが密結合になってバグの原因になり、プログラムを把握することも極めて困難になる。 そもそも、熟達したプログラマの感覚では、業務で書くアプリケーションの実装に継承を使うべき局面などほとんど無い。ライブラリ等のより低レベルな処理で仕様が確定しているものについては、継承が効果的となる場合もあるが、複雑なアプリケーションのロジックに継承を使うのはほとんどの場合、時期尚早な抽象化となる。 また、凡庸なプログラマが継承で実現したい
最近、そう思うことが多い。プログラミングの勉強をしていると、僕と年齢の変わらないすごい人がたくさんいる。憧れる。そういう人たちはだいたい早い頃からプログラミングに触れていて、僕ももっとはやくプログラミングをはじめていればよかったと思う。 頭が悪かった、というよりも勉強をしなさすぎて大学に行けずに専門学校に入学し、そこで初めてプログラミングを勉強した。それからは自分の好きなものを試行錯誤しながら作っては快感を得ていた。自分が思うものを作れるのはとても楽しかった。そうやっているうちに、僕と変わらない歳の人が手の届かないレベルにたくさんいることがわかった。焦った。でも、自分なりに必死に頑張ってはいるけれども追いつける気がしない。プログラミングをはじめた頃に比べれば格段に成長しているけれど、それでも全然届かない。 もっとはやくプログラミングをはじめていれば、違ったんだろうか。そう思ったところで意味
長い間、フリーランスなどという「便利屋」をこなしていると、馴染みの顧客から、トラブったプロジェクトに急遽参画してほしいという、ヘルプ案件が入ってきたりする。 嫌かと言われるとそうでもなく、むしろ、恩を着せて(足元を見るとも言う)高単価を取るチャンスだし、案件が燃え上がっているのは他人のせいであり、途中から入る私は気楽なものなので、積極的に首をつっこむことにしている。 こう言うと颯爽と現れるスーパーマンのようでかっこいいのだが、そこはクソ雑魚フリーランスの私。トラブルの内容というのは、「安いWordpress業者に頼んだ案件で、途中で、(カスタマイズ要件)がやっぱり出来ないと言われた」とか「アプリが毎回メモリリークで5分で落ちるのだが、全く治る気配がない」とかそういう情けない話ばかりである。 共通して言えるのは、炎上させた業者が「(問題を解決することが)出来ません」とはっきり言ってしまってい
Web系やシステム系のエンジニアは、一生プログラムを書いていたいのだろうか。僕自身は、こういう言説をどう捉えていいのかよくわからない。むしろこういう言説は少しネガティブだ。 僕自身のキャリアは、もともと機械製造業の電気制御の設計で、現場で物を作る立場から、設計へと移動した流れ。その会社では大卒入社組は製造での経験を経て、設計職に行くパスになっていた。いわゆるテレビ東京とかが好きな意味での「ものづくりの現場仕事」ではなく、設計を通じて「製造部門や調達部門に指示を出す役割」である。 もちろん電気制御なのでプログラムは書くが「プログラマー」ではなくて、あくまでも「技術者」という枠組みで捉えている。 ハードもソフトも全部やるってことだけど、全部を自分で作れるわけじゃなくあくまでチーム戦。如何に人にお願いし、いいものを作ってもらうかというのも技術者の仕事だと思っている。外注さんにもお願いするし、パー
私はもともと普通のプログラマとしてキャリアをスタートしましたが、2007年くらいから脱プログラマを目指してソフトウェア起業家として経営に軸足を移してきました。 それから8年くらいが経過して思うのは、経営者として大きな成功をおさめる前に、自分のプログラマとしての実力がめきめきとアップしてしまったということです。 8年前の私は、プログラマとしては基礎力はあるものの全般的には未熟であったように思います。コードも荒削りで、とにかくかろうじて動くものを作ることに四苦八苦していました。が、いまはプログラマとしてずっと良い仕事ができています。 この8年間は、自分でコードも書いていたので、経験が増えたことによって、良いコードを書けるようになったという面も多々あるとは思います。しかし、そのあいだ技術書を読むことはすっかりやめてしまい、流行の技術などは完全無視してきました。 経営層の一員として働くので、プロジ
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く